Working For A Nuclear Free City, Schubas 3/5/08

Last night I saw the excellent Manchester band Working For A Nuclear Free City. They only played for a short time, but they sounded really good (Schubas has a good soundsystem?) They rocked a little harder than I thought they would based on their album.
I really think they have a unique sound, it's a mix of early nineties "baggy" or "madchester" bands, modern indie rock, and lush, dream-like, M83 style shoegaze.---Is it? They remind me a bit of James with a quieter vocal sound. They are quickly becoming one of my new favorite bands! So here's the obligatory pictures and videos I took at the show!
